The 246 nm AlN-delta-GaN quantum well ultraviolet light-emitting diode was proposed and realized experimentally, with the dominant transverse electric-polarized emission been verified by both the k·p simulation and the room-temperature polarization-dependent electroluminescence measurements.

A new laser facility with 30kJ/ns/3ω(8 beams) output energy has begun operation with good performance. Another single laser prototype pushes 1ω output energy to 17.5kJ/21ns in 350mm×350mm aperture with four-pass main amplifier architecture.

We investigate the temperature dependence of CrossTalk (CT) for PANDA Polarization maintaining fiber (PMF). The test temperature ranges from −55 to 85 °C, and the tested fiber was loose wound. The mismatch in thermal expansion coefficient between the boron-doped parts and the core can be varied by controlling the doping concentration in the stress and core regions. GOPA is a radiation hardened GNSS baseband ASIC produced on the 65 nm 7-layer metal process technology. GOPA is capable of processing signals from GPS and BDS. A lot of lab tests had been carried out after tape-out of GOPA. The experiment results showed that the performances of GOPA were in good agreement with the design goals, the TID, SEL and SEU of the ASIC fulfilled the design requirements. GOPA...
